Slow-release base fertilizer capable of increasing wheat yield and preparation method of slow release base fertilizer
A technology of basal fertilizer and yield, applied in application, nitrogen fertilizer, magnesium fertilizer, etc., can solve problems affecting wheat yield and quality, unreasonable nutrient distribution ratio, poor slow-release effect of basal fertilizer, etc., to enhance wheat stress resistance and prolong biological growth. Embodiment 1
[0020] A kind of slow-release base fertilizer for improving wheat yield proposed by the present invention, its raw material comprises by weight: 450 parts of organic fertilizer, 40 parts of polypeptide urea, 15 parts of superphosphate, 60 parts of potassium nitrate, 1 part of boric acid, 3 parts of magnesium sulfate 1 part of zinc citrate, 1.2 parts of manganese carbonate, 0.5 parts of iron fertilizer, 2 parts of fulvic acid, 3 parts of citric acid, 15 parts of coating solution, 0.08 part of Pythium oligandrum, 0.03 part of Bacillus, 0.02 part of Rhizobium parts, Bacillus licheniformis 0.04 parts.
[0021] A kind of preparation method that the present invention also proposes to improve wheat production slow-release base fertilizer, comprises the following steps:

Embodiment 3
[0036] A kind of slow-release base fertilizer for improving wheat yield proposed by the present invention, its raw material comprises by weight: 550 parts of organic fertilizer, 50 parts of polypeptide urea, 20 parts of superphosphate, 50 parts of potassium nitrate, 1.5 parts of boric acid, 2 parts of magnesium sulfate 1.5 parts of zinc citrate, 1 part of manganese carbonate, 0.8 parts of iron fertilizer, 3 parts of fulvic acid, 2 parts of citric acid, 22 parts of coating solution, 0.06 parts of Pythium oligandrum, 0.05 parts of Bacillus, 0.03 parts of Rhizobium parts, Bacillus licheniformis 0.03 parts.
[0037] Among them, the raw materials of organic fertilizer include by weight: 350 parts of livestock and poultry manure, 40 parts of soybean meal, 15 parts of hay, 15 parts of dead leaves, 15 parts of sesame husks, 16 parts of wheat husks, 8 parts of animal bone meal, and 8 parts of selenium-enriched yeast powder. parts, 15 parts of agricultural rare earth;
